Abstract
Scintillation of a radio signal passing through solar corona is considered. The expression describing a time profile of these scintillations on the basis of multibeam propagation of radio waves is derived. It is determined that the time profile of scintillations caused by multibeam propagation may appear as impulses of emission or absorption or may have sawtooth form. The assuming of the specific emission source features is not the only way to explain the shape of impulses, since the effect of multibeam propagation of radio waves through solar corona and interplanetary space yields a simple explanation of the phenomenon discussed.
